Texter och textstycken

Dynamix CMS hanterar textstycken såsom i följande exempel:

<h1 class=”headline1”>Detta är en rubrik</h1>

<p class=”normal”>Detta är ett textstycke</p>

Du ser här att man kopplar på en css-klass för varje texttyp. Man kan lägga till valfritt antal texttyper för en webblösning.

Det som man skall tänka på när man sätter CSS-stilar för dessa stycken är att inte helt och hållet förlita sig på default-marginaler för text <p>. Detta då Dynamix av tekniska skäl gör om alla <p></p> stycken till <div></div> just under redigering.

Ange även marginaler efter stycken på ett sådant sätt att man inte behöver skapa extra radmatningar för varje stycke.

Punktlistor

I editorn kan man man skapa punktlistor i en nivå. Dessa kodas på följande sätt:

  1. C#
  1. <ol class="dxOl>
  2. <li><p class=”normal”></p></li>
  3. <li><p class=”normal”></p></li>
  4. </ol>

Se till att sätta style i CSS-filen för punktlistorna

Nummerlistor

I editorn kan man man skapa nummerlistor i en nivå. Dessa kodas på följande sätt:

  1. C#
  1. <ul class="dxUl>
  2. <li><p class=”normal”></p></li>
  3. <li><p class=”normal”></p></li>
  4. </ul>

Se till att sätta style i CSS-filen för dessa.

Länkar

Det är inga hemligheter i hur länkar kodas. De ligger i textstyckena enligt följande exempel:

  1. C#
  1. <p class="normal"><a href="http://www.initiva.se"></p>

Exempel på kodning av stil-klasser:

  1. C#
  1. .normal
  2. {
  3. font-family:verdana;
  4. font-size:1em;
  5. color:#000000;
  6. margin-bottom:1em;
  7. line-heigh:1.5em
  8. }
  9. .normal a
  10. {
  11. text-decoration:none;
  12. color:#0000ff;
  13. }
  14. .normal a:active,
  15. .normal a:focus,
  16. .normal a:hover
  17. {
  18. color:#ff0000;
  19. }